General Information about #241B3C

The hexadecimal color #241B3C, also known as Steel Gray, is a dark, muted shade that evokes feelings of sophistication and solemnity. It is composed of 14.12% red, 10.59% green, and 23.53% blue. In the RGB color space, it is defined by the values R:36, G:27, and B:60. In the CMYK color space, it is defined by the values C:0.4, M:0.55, Y:0.0, K:0.76. The hex color #241B3C presents accessibility challenges, especially when used for text or interactive elements. Its low luminance value results in poor contrast against standard white backgrounds, potentially violating WCAG (Web Content Accessibility Guidelines) standards. To ensure readability, it is crucial to use a lighter color for text or a contrasting background color. A contrast ratio of at least 4.5:1 is recommended for normal text and 3:1 for large text. Tools like contrast checkers can help evaluate color combinations. When employing this color in user interface elements, consider providing alternative visual cues to enhance usability for users with visual impairments. Careful attention to color pairings is essential for creating inclusive and accessible designs.
